6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Define 'Old Money' in the context of The Great Gatsby.
Back
Old Money refers to families that have been wealthy for generations, often associated with East Egg.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Define 'New Money' in the context of The Great Gatsby.
Back
New Money refers to individuals or families who have recently acquired wealth, often associated with West Egg.
